Help wanted: $78,000 a year to taste candy while sitting
on your couch

Alexandra Peers

Candy Funhouse, an online shop that sells from chocolate bars to gummies and licorice, is hiring for a $78,000 a year, work-from-home job as its Chief Candy Officer. Duties include: “leading candy board meetings, being the head taste tester and all things fun. Several thousand candidates have already applied for the position”, said Chief Executive Officer Jamal Hejazi. He noted that he’s been surprised by the number of applications and the elaborate videos of entire families offering to share the tasting duties and the salary. (...) Candy Funhouse, based outside of Toronto, is headed by a quartet of 20-and-30-something-yearold siblings who grew up in the area and parents owned donut shops and a local restaurant. (...) Hejazi noted that reports on social media claiming that the Chief Candy Officer will be required to eat 3,500 pieces of candy per month are incorrect. “That’s too many”, Hejazi said.

According to the text, write T for true and F for false. Then, choose the alternative with the correct sequence.

( ) Few people in the USA left their jobs because of COVID-19.

( ) Working is tiring, either doing it from home or from an office.

( ) When the inflation increased, the plans to increase the salaries didn’t work.

( ) Low salaries and family care were some reasons why Americans stopped working.
